December 18To the Morning

It was the cool gray dawn, and there was a delicious sense of repose and peace in the deep pervading calm and silence of the woods. Not a leaf stirred; not a sound obtruded upon great Nature's meditation … Gradually the cool dim gray of the morning whitened, and as gradually sounds multiplied and life manifested itself. The marvel of Nature shaking off sleep and going to work unfolded itself to the musing boy … All Nature was wide awake and stirring, now; long lances of sunlight pierced down through the dense foliage far and near.

Mark Twain—The Adventures of Tom Sawyer (1876)

Good morning. (Even if it's not morning where you are now.)

Entrepreneurs famously code and write and design late into the night and often miss what Twain so mystically describes in today's reading.

Morning comes on slowly as our days should. Morning allows us to choose the tone for our day. Morning affords the weightlessness to decide our priorities. Morning allows the space to make decisions about how we want our day to unfold, including when we want to be done.

There's a Dan Fogelberg song (“To the Morning”) that includes these inspiring lyrics:

And it's going to be a day

There is really no way to say no

To the morning.
